Furthermore, nearly 40% of the employment agreements for Autonomy 5 baseball coaches include bonus provisions tied to base salary or total compensation, which creates a significant compensation compounding effect (See more). As we found in our last survey of Autonomy 5 head baseball coaches,compared to Autonomy 5 head baseball coaches (MBB & WBB), head football coaches and athletics directors, bonuses represent a disproportionately high percentage of available compensation.
